Market Overview
The pricing of stainless steel pipe exports from China to the Middle East hinges on several key cost components, including raw materials like iron ore and coke, energy, labor, foreign exchange (FX) rates, and the export tax rebate regime. Chinese manufacturers, such as Feihong Steel Co., Ltd., structure their pricing by closely monitoring these factors to remain competitive. Verified entities like Feihong Steel, which boast a USD 2,000,000 platform deposit and Diamond Member status since 2021, exemplify the commitment to maintaining quality and compliance in this dynamic market.
- Raw Material Costs: Fluctuations in iron ore and coke prices significantly impact final pricing. Manufacturers must adapt quickly to changes in these global commodities.
- Energy & Labor: Rising energy costs and labor wages contribute to the overall production expense, influencing export prices.
- Export Tax Rebate: The Chinese government's tax rebate policies can provide financial relief, effectively lowering export pricing for suppliers like Feihong Steel.
Standards such as ASTM A53 Gr.B and quality checks by third-party agencies like SGS and Bureau Veritas ensure that the products meet international requirements. Additionally, regulatory factors like the EU's Carbon Border Adjustment Mechanism (CBAM) are increasingly relevant, affecting how Chinese steel is priced and exported to different regions. Cost Structure and Quote Components
The cost structure for exporting stainless steel pipe from China to the Middle East involves several crucial components, including FOB, CIF, and CFR pricing, which are influenced by export tax rebates and tariffs. Feihong Steel Co., Ltd., a verified supplier and Diamond Member since 2021, typically offers competitive terms like a USD 2,000,000 platform deposit, signaling reliability and financial stability. The pricing strategy often incorporates Chinese export tax rebates, which can lower the FOB price, offering a cost advantage to buyers.
- FOB Pricing: Freight on Board (FOB) pricing is calculated at the port of shipment, such as Lianyungang or Shanghai, with the buyer covering freight costs from there.
- CIF Pricing: Cost, Insurance, and Freight (CIF) pricing includes freight and insurance to the destination port, providing an all-inclusive cost model.
- CFR Pricing: Cost and Freight (CFR) pricing covers the cost and freight to the destination port, but excludes insurance, which the buyer must arrange.

How long are Chinese steel quotes typically valid?
Chinese steel quotes generally remain valid for 7 to 14 days. This period allows buyers to make purchasing decisions while accounting for fluctuations in raw material costs and market demand.
What payment structures are common for first-time vs. repeat buyers in the steel industry?
First-time buyers often use a Letter of Credit (LC), while repeat buyers may prefer Open Account terms. These structures provide security for initial transactions and flexibility for ongoing business.
How do export tax rebates impact the FOB price of Chinese stainless steel pipes?
Export tax rebates can reduce the FOB price by offsetting costs, making Chinese stainless steel pipes more competitive in international markets. These rebates are a strategic tool to encourage exports.
